The GE IC600YB842 operates as a high-precision analog input module within the Versamax series from GE Fanuc Emerson. This module expertly converts real-world analog signals into digital data for industrial control applications. It therefore enables accurate monitoring of process variables like pressure, flow, and position.

Input Configuration and Performance
The GE IC600YB842 features eight differential input channels that reject common-mode noise for superior accuracy. Each channel accepts signals across the full -10 V to +10 V industrial range. The module’s 12-bit resolution provides 4096 discrete steps for precise measurement representation.
Isolation and Protection Features
The GE IC600YB842 incorporates optical isolation between field inputs and the backplane interface. This isolation protects sensitive control electronics from voltage transients and ground loops. The module consequently maintains signal integrity even in harsh industrial environments.
Power and Environmental Specifications
The GE IC600YB842 requires a nominal 5 V DC power supply drawing 1.5 Amps from the backplane. Its operating temperature range of 0°C to 60°C suits most industrial control cabinet installations. The module also withstands storage temperatures from -20°C to 80°C during shipping.
